The Molecular Science of the Physical Shield: Mineral vs. Chemical

Constructing a non-toxic defense system requires an analytical breakdown of how active ingredients interact with human tissue.

The Chemical Absorption Hazard: Conventional sunscreens rely on a synthetic cocktail of aromatic carbon compounds, including oxybenzone, avobenzone, octinoxate, homosalate, and octocrylene. Because these molecules possess a tiny molecular weight, they easily penetrate the stratum corneum, slipping past tight junctions to accumulate inside fat tissues and organs. Oxybenzone, in particular, acts as a notorious endocrine disruptor, mimicking estrogen and disrupting delicate thyroid pathways. Furthermore, when these chemical bonds break down UV light, they generate an internal cascade of thermal energy and free radicals, accelerating the precise signs of premature aging they are supposed to prevent.

The Mineral Reflection Mechanism: True non-toxic sunblock relies exclusively on purified, earth-mined minerals: Zinc Oxide and Titanium Dioxide. Specifically, non-nano Zinc Oxide is the ultimate gold standard of sun safety. The term “non-nano” dictates that the mineral particles are larger than 100 nanometers, meaning they are physically too large to penetrate the skin barrier or enter human cells. Zinc oxide sits completely inert on the surface of the skin, acting as a broad-spectrum mirror that refracts both aging UVA waves and burning UVB waves away from the body with zero systemic absorption.

The Application Protocol for Maximized Mineral Defense

Because non-toxic mineral formulas act as a physical barrier rather than a chemical absorbency layer, proper placement technique completely dictates the efficiency of the shield.

  • Step 1: The Two-Finger Measurement: Never skimp on mineral protection out of fear of heavy texture. Squeeze two clean lines of your chosen mineral SPF directly from the base of the index and middle fingers to the tips. This exact volume ensures full, verified broad-spectrum coverage across the face, neck, and ears.
  • Step 2: The Dot and Pat Distribution: Do not aggressively rub a mineral sunscreen into the face like a traditional lotion. Rubbing can create streaks and thin patches in the physical barrier. Instead, dot the fluid evenly across the forehead, cheeks, nose, and chin. Use flat, open palms to gently pat and press the product into the skin, allowing the plant lipids to emulsify naturally against the warmth of the face.
  • Step 3: The Immediate Sun Launch: Unlike chemical sunscreens that demand a tedious 20-minute waiting period to absorb and activate, mineral sunblocks are functional the absolute millisecond they hit the face. The physical mirror is instantly active, allowing a prompt step out into the bright daylight with complete peace of mind.
